**we used our magic bands for everything and they were awesome!! we had no problems at all with them. we used them to get on the magical express at the airport, to get food (snacks in parks, table service and counter/quick service), to get into the parks, for our fast pass stuff, to make room charges, and for our photopass pictures. they were great and, even though i was worried about how they'd be, i really enjoyed having them.

**i bought the regular photopass option before our trip. now they have the memory maker. if you're still up in the air, i'd say get the memory maker. if you buy it before your trip, it's $149 and includes all pictures, ones the photopass photographers take, ones at meals, and ride photos. i didn't think i would want any of those extra things, and didn't want to spend the extra $30 for it. well, i could have saved us $40 because we ended up buying our pictures at two of the character dinners we did. each of those was $35, but would have been free if we'd had MM. also, we did the pirates league and could have had those pictures too. instead, we just took pictures ourselves and didn't buy the photos they took, even though they were SUPER cute! if we had gotten the MM, all of those would have been included....live and learn!
one other thing about pictures--i don't know if it was the time of year, the weather, or what, but i did not see very many photopass photographers out. and the ones out had lines, sometimes kind of long. i was sort of bummed not to get more pictures for our money.

**last, fastpass plus and mydisneyexperinece.com were great! i changed fast passes in the park and checked times and used maps with no problems. it was a really nice thing to have on my phone. i also really liked having the fast passes set up before hand. i really didn't think i would like it, but it worked out super for us!​

sunday, jan 5: day 1--will we get out of st louis?

the morning of sunday, january 5, we were up at about 4:30 am, mostly because i couldn't sleep. i thought i'd have a half hour or so to get ready and pack up last minute things, but madison was up a few minutes later. she ran into the kitchen and asked "are we leaving for disney now?!?" when i told her yes, she screamed and ran into the bedroom and woke up her sister. so much for a quiet start to the day!

we all got ready and took our dog out one more time. we loaded up the car and were off the the airport. did i mention that snow and arctic cold temps were on their way to st louis? yeah.....we were crossing our fingers that we'd get out of the airport and thinking we should have tried to leave the night before.

we got to the airport and parked in the long term parking. a bus was already there and he came right over and picked us up. score! no standing in the snow for us. we were the only ones on the bus and took our first vacation picture!

we got checked in and through security quickly. there's something to be said about leaving at the crack of dawn on a sunday!

we didn't have a long wait and boarded with the family group. the flight wasn't full and we had an empty seat in our row, so we got comfy and waited to leave. we got to see the plane get de-iced for the first time. the girls liked watching the "pink stuff" get sprayed on the plane. the pilot said we were probably one of the last planes out, as the airport may close for the storm! woo hoo, pixie dust already!

we finally arrived in orlando and made our way down to hop on the magical express--without getting lost this time! we used our magic bands, no problem, and got in line. there was a bit of a wait as we had just missed a bus, but it wasn't too bad. we made friends with the man behind us. he told us all about our hotel as he had stayed there before and talked about goofy with hannah, since goofy is his favorite character too! the girls also loved that his phone played "scooby, scooby doo, where are you?" when his wife called. he was pretty awesome!
